Dante is one of the most powerful tools in live audio right now and understanding how to use it can make playback during gigs and soundchecks so much easier.
In this video, we'll connect a Yamaha QL1 mixer to a DAW using the built-in Dante card. I'm using Reaper but this should work with any DAW. If you have a different mixer with a Dante card inserted then the process should be similar.

Hey Kevin, interesting situation and thanks for the detail. My first thought reading it is that you would probably need separate return channels for the sound coming back from the laptop, though perhaps I'm reading too much into the situation. Are you recording the audio and then trying to play it back afterwards with reaper or are you trying to monitor it in real-time? If you've got the tracks coming into reaper then you've won half the battle and you know that you have communication between your dante card and DVS, and it's set up correctly in reaper. My list of things to check would be are: Are the reaper outs set to individual DVS outs? Are the subscriptions in Dante controller set up correctly? Is the card on the GLD subscribed to sound from DVS? Are the input channels on the GLD then set to receive sound from those dante inputs? Are there any inserts or anything that could prevent the incoming sound reaching the fader? These are just the things I can think of off the top of my head but please let me know how you get on!

Had a similar issue, turns out Avast antivirus was blocking everything because I was connecting directly and there was no DHCP server so the network is considered a public network. A fix is to turn off antivirus, add in a router that gives DHCP, or manually go through PowerShell and manually set your Ethernet to private
